Now is a good time . . .

If any one rides a motorbike, now is a good time to ensure you have got the telephone number of your breakdown / recovery service stored on your mobile phone.

Don't wait until you get a rear wheel puncture on one of the busiest road traffic islands in the centre of Birmingham, during the early morning rush hour and then realise that you don't have it. Embarassed
